+// UserType defines the user type
+type UserType int //revive:disable-line:exported
+
+const (
+ // UserTypeIndividual defines an individual user
+ UserTypeIndividual UserType = iota // Historic reason to make it starts at 0.
+
+ // UserTypeOrganization defines an organization
+ UserTypeOrganization
+
+ // UserTypeUserReserved reserves a (non-existing) user, i.e. to prevent a spam user from re-registering after being deleted, or to reserve the name until the user is actually created later on
+ UserTypeUserReserved
+
+ // UserTypeOrganizationReserved reserves a (non-existing) organization, to be used in combination with UserTypeUserReserved
+ UserTypeOrganizationReserved
+
+ // UserTypeBot defines a bot user
+ UserTypeBot
+
+ // UserTypeRemoteUser defines a remote user for federated users
+ UserTypeRemoteUser
+)
+
+const (
+ // EmailNotificationsEnabled indicates that the user would like to receive all email notifications except your own
+ EmailNotificationsEnabled = "enabled"
+ // EmailNotificationsOnMention indicates that the user would like to be notified via email when mentioned.
+ EmailNotificationsOnMention = "onmention"
+ // EmailNotificationsDisabled indicates that the user would not like to be notified via email.
+ EmailNotificationsDisabled = "disabled"
+ // EmailNotificationsAndYourOwn indicates that the user would like to receive all email notifications and your own
+ EmailNotificationsAndYourOwn = "andyourown"
+)
+
+// User represents the object of individual and member of organization.
+type User struct {
+ ID int64 `xorm:"pk autoincr"`
+ LowerName string `xorm:"UNIQUE NOT NULL"`
+ Name string `xorm:"UNIQUE NOT NULL"`
+ FullName string
+ // Email is the primary email address (to be used for communication)
+ Email string `xorm:"NOT NULL"`
+ KeepEmailPrivate bool
+ EmailNotificationsPreference string `xorm:"VARCHAR(20) NOT NULL DEFAULT 'enabled'"`
+ Passwd string `xorm:"NOT NULL"`
+ PasswdHashAlgo string `xorm:"NOT NULL DEFAULT 'argon2'"`
+
+ // MustChangePassword is an attribute that determines if a user
+ // is to change their password after registration.
+ MustChangePassword bool `xorm:"NOT NULL DEFAULT false"`
+
+ LoginType auth.Type
+ LoginSource int64 `xorm:"NOT NULL DEFAULT 0"`
+ LoginName string
+ Type UserType
+ Location string
+ Website string
+ Pronouns string
+ Rands string `xorm:"VARCHAR(32)"`
+ Salt string `xorm:"VARCHAR(32)"`
+ Language string `xorm:"VARCHAR(5)"`
+ Description string
+
+ CreatedUnix timeutil.TimeStamp `xorm:"INDEX created"`
+ UpdatedUnix timeutil.TimeStamp `xorm:"INDEX updated"`
+ LastLoginUnix timeutil.TimeStamp `xorm:"INDEX"`
+
+ // Remember visibility choice for convenience, true for private
+ LastRepoVisibility bool
+ // Maximum repository creation limit, -1 means use global default
+ MaxRepoCreation int `xorm:"NOT NULL DEFAULT -1"`
+
+ // IsActive true: primary email is activated, user can access Web UI and Git SSH.
+ // false: an inactive user can only log in Web UI for account operations (ex: activate the account by email), no other access.
+ IsActive bool `xorm:"INDEX"`
+ // the user is a Gitea admin, who can access all repositories and the admin pages.
+ IsAdmin bool
+ // true: the user is only allowed to see organizations/repositories that they has explicit rights to.
+ // (ex: in private Gitea instances user won't be allowed to see even organizations/repositories that are set as public)
+ IsRestricted bool `xorm:"NOT NULL DEFAULT false"`
+
+ AllowGitHook bool
+ AllowImportLocal bool // Allow migrate repository by local path
+ AllowCreateOrganization bool `xorm:"DEFAULT true"`
+
+ // true: the user is not allowed to log in Web UI. Git/SSH access could still be allowed (please refer to Git/SSH access related code/documents)
+ ProhibitLogin bool `xorm:"NOT NULL DEFAULT false"`
+
+ // Avatar
+ Avatar string `xorm:"VARCHAR(2048) NOT NULL"`
+ AvatarEmail string `xorm:"NOT NULL"`
+ UseCustomAvatar bool
+
+ // For federation
+ NormalizedFederatedURI string
+
+ // Counters
+ NumFollowers int
+ NumFollowing int `xorm:"NOT NULL DEFAULT 0"`
+ NumStars int
+ NumRepos int
+
+ // For organization
+ NumTeams int
+ NumMembers int
+ Visibility structs.VisibleType `xorm:"NOT NULL DEFAULT 0"`
+ RepoAdminChangeTeamAccess bool `xorm:"NOT NULL DEFAULT false"`
+
+ // Preferences
+ DiffViewStyle string `xorm:"NOT NULL DEFAULT ''"`
+ Theme string `xorm:"NOT NULL DEFAULT ''"`
+ KeepActivityPrivate bool `xorm:"NOT NULL DEFAULT false"`
+ EnableRepoUnitHints bool `xorm:"NOT NULL DEFAULT true"`
+}

+// Note: As of the beginning of 2022, it is recommended to use at least
+// 64 bits of salt, but NIST is already recommending to use to 128 bits.
+// (16 bytes = 16 * 8 = 128 bits)
+const SaltByteLength = 16
+
+// GetUserSalt returns a random user salt token.
+func GetUserSalt() (string, error) {
+ rBytes, err := util.CryptoRandomBytes(SaltByteLength)
+ if err != nil {
+ return "", err
+ }
+ // Returns a 32 bytes long string.
+ return hex.EncodeToString(rBytes), nil
+}
+
+// Note: The set of characters here can safely expand without a breaking change,
+// but characters removed from this set can cause user account linking to break
+var (
+ customCharsReplacement = strings.NewReplacer("Æ", "AE")
+ removeCharsRE = regexp.MustCompile(`['´\x60]`)
+ removeDiacriticsTransform = transform.Chain(norm.NFD, runes.Remove(runes.In(unicode.Mn)), norm.NFC)
+ replaceCharsHyphenRE = regexp.MustCompile(`[\s~+]`)
+)
+
+// normalizeUserName returns a string with single-quotes and diacritics
+// removed, and any other non-supported username characters replaced with
+// a `-` character
+func NormalizeUserName(s string) (string, error) {
+ strDiacriticsRemoved, n, err := transform.String(removeDiacriticsTransform, customCharsReplacement.Replace(s))
+ if err != nil {
+ return "", fmt.Errorf("Failed to normalize character `%v` in provided username `%v`", s[n], s)
+ }
+ return replaceCharsHyphenRE.ReplaceAllLiteralString(removeCharsRE.ReplaceAllLiteralString(strDiacriticsRemoved, ""), "-"), nil
+}

+// CreateUser creates record of a new user.
+func CreateUser(ctx context.Context, u *User, overwriteDefault ...*CreateUserOverwriteOptions) (err error) {
+ return createUser(ctx, u, false, overwriteDefault...)
+}
+
+// AdminCreateUser is used by admins to manually create users
+func AdminCreateUser(ctx context.Context, u *User, overwriteDefault ...*CreateUserOverwriteOptions) (err error) {
+ return createUser(ctx, u, true, overwriteDefault...)
+}
+
+// createUser creates record of a new user.
+func createUser(ctx context.Context, u *User, createdByAdmin bool, overwriteDefault ...*CreateUserOverwriteOptions) (err error) {
+ if err = IsUsableUsername(u.Name); err != nil {
+ return err
+ }
+
+ // set system defaults
+ u.KeepEmailPrivate = setting.Service.DefaultKeepEmailPrivate
+ u.Visibility = setting.Service.DefaultUserVisibilityMode
+ u.AllowCreateOrganization = setting.Service.DefaultAllowCreateOrganization && !setting.Admin.DisableRegularOrgCreation
+ u.EmailNotificationsPreference = setting.Admin.DefaultEmailNotification
+ u.MaxRepoCreation = -1
+ u.Theme = setting.UI.DefaultTheme
+ u.IsRestricted = setting.Service.DefaultUserIsRestricted
+ u.IsActive = !(setting.Service.RegisterEmailConfirm || setting.Service.RegisterManualConfirm)
+
+ // Ensure consistency of the dates.
+ if u.UpdatedUnix < u.CreatedUnix {
+ u.UpdatedUnix = u.CreatedUnix
+ }
+
+ // overwrite defaults if set
+ if len(overwriteDefault) != 0 && overwriteDefault[0] != nil {
+ overwrite := overwriteDefault[0]
+ if overwrite.KeepEmailPrivate.Has() {
+ u.KeepEmailPrivate = overwrite.KeepEmailPrivate.Value()
+ }
+ if overwrite.Visibility != nil {
+ u.Visibility = *overwrite.Visibility
+ }
+ if overwrite.AllowCreateOrganization.Has() {
+ u.AllowCreateOrganization = overwrite.AllowCreateOrganization.Value()
+ }
+ if overwrite.EmailNotificationsPreference != nil {
+ u.EmailNotificationsPreference = *overwrite.EmailNotificationsPreference
+ }
+ if overwrite.MaxRepoCreation != nil {
+ u.MaxRepoCreation = *overwrite.MaxRepoCreation
+ }
+ if overwrite.Theme != nil {
+ u.Theme = *overwrite.Theme
+ }
+ if overwrite.IsRestricted.Has() {
+ u.IsRestricted = overwrite.IsRestricted.Value()
+ }
+ if overwrite.IsActive.Has() {
+ u.IsActive = overwrite.IsActive.Value()
+ }
+ }
+
+ // validate data
+ if err := ValidateUser(u); err != nil {
+ return err
+ }
+
+ if createdByAdmin {
+ if err := ValidateEmailForAdmin(u.Email); err != nil {
+ return err
+ }
+ } else {
+ if err := ValidateEmail(u.Email); err != nil {
+ return err
+ }
+ }
+
+ ctx, committer, err := db.TxContext(ctx)
+ if err != nil {
+ return err
+ }
+ defer committer.Close()
+
+ isExist, err := IsUserExist(ctx, 0, u.Name)
+ if err != nil {
+ return err
+ } else if isExist {
+ return ErrUserAlreadyExist{u.Name}
+ }
+
+ isExist, err = IsEmailUsed(ctx, u.Email)
+ if err != nil {
+ return err
+ } else if isExist {
+ return ErrEmailAlreadyUsed{
+ Email: u.Email,
+ }
+ }
+
+ // prepare for database
+
+ u.LowerName = strings.ToLower(u.Name)
+ u.AvatarEmail = u.Email
+ if u.Rands, err = GetUserSalt(); err != nil {
+ return err
+ }
+ if u.Passwd != "" {
+ if err = u.SetPassword(u.Passwd); err != nil {
+ return err
+ }
+ } else {
+ u.Salt = ""
+ u.PasswdHashAlgo = ""
+ }
+
+ // save changes to database
+
+ if err = DeleteUserRedirect(ctx, u.Name); err != nil {
+ return err
+ }
+
+ if u.CreatedUnix == 0 {
+ // Caller expects auto-time for creation & update timestamps.
+ err = db.Insert(ctx, u)
+ } else {
+ // Caller sets the timestamps themselves. They are responsible for ensuring
+ // both `CreatedUnix` and `UpdatedUnix` are set appropriately.
+ _, err = db.GetEngine(ctx).NoAutoTime().Insert(u)
+ }
+ if err != nil {
+ return err
+ }
+
+ // insert email address
+ if err := db.Insert(ctx, &EmailAddress{
+ UID: u.ID,
+ Email: u.Email,
+ LowerEmail: strings.ToLower(u.Email),
+ IsActivated: u.IsActive,
+ IsPrimary: true,
+ }); err != nil {
+ return err
+ }
+
+ return committer.Commit()
+}

+func isUserVisibleToViewerCond(viewer *User) builder.Cond {
+ if viewer != nil && viewer.IsAdmin {
+ return builder.NewCond()
+ }
+
+ if viewer == nil || viewer.IsRestricted {
+ return builder.Eq{
+ "`user`.visibility": structs.VisibleTypePublic,
+ }
+ }
+
+ return builder.Neq{
+ "`user`.visibility": structs.VisibleTypePrivate,
+ }.Or(
+ // viewer self
+ builder.Eq{"`user`.id": viewer.ID},
+ // viewer's following
+ builder.In("`user`.id",
+ builder.
+ Select("`follow`.user_id").
+ From("follow").
+ Where(builder.Eq{"`follow`.follow_id": viewer.ID})),
+ // viewer's org user
+ builder.In("`user`.id",
+ builder.
+ Select("`team_user`.uid").
+ From("team_user").
+ Join("INNER", "`team_user` AS t2", "`team_user`.org_id = `t2`.org_id").
+ Where(builder.Eq{"`t2`.uid": viewer.ID})),
+ // viewer's org
+ builder.In("`user`.id",
+ builder.
+ Select("`team_user`.org_id").
+ From("team_user").
+ Where(builder.Eq{"`team_user`.uid": viewer.ID})))
+}
+
+// IsUserVisibleToViewer check if viewer is able to see user profile
+func IsUserVisibleToViewer(ctx context.Context, u, viewer *User) bool {
+ if viewer != nil && (viewer.IsAdmin || viewer.ID == u.ID) {
+ return true
+ }
+
+ switch u.Visibility {
+ case structs.VisibleTypePublic:
+ return true
+ case structs.VisibleTypeLimited:
+ if viewer == nil || viewer.IsRestricted {
+ return false
+ }
+ return true
+ case structs.VisibleTypePrivate:
+ if viewer == nil || viewer.IsRestricted {
+ return false
+ }
+
+ // If they follow - they see each over
+ follower := IsFollowing(ctx, u.ID, viewer.ID)
+ if follower {
+ return true
+ }
+
+ // Now we need to check if they in some organization together
+ count, err := db.GetEngine(ctx).Table("team_user").
+ Where(
+ builder.And(
+ builder.Eq{"uid": viewer.ID},
+ builder.Or(
+ builder.Eq{"org_id": u.ID},
+ builder.In("org_id",
+ builder.Select("org_id").
+ From("team_user", "t2").
+ Where(builder.Eq{"uid": u.ID}))))).
+ Count()
+ if err != nil {
+ return false
+ }
+
+ if count == 0 {
+ // No common organization
+ return false
+ }
+
+ // they are in an organization together
+ return true
+ }
+ return false
+}
